To detect noisy plumbing, it is important to figure out first whether the undesirable audios happen on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Noises on the inlet side have actually differed causes: excessive water stress, worn valve and tap parts, improperly attached pumps or other home appliances, improperly put pipe fasteners, and also plumbing runs having too many tight bends or other limitations. Noises on the drainpipe side typically originate from bad place or, similar to some inlet side sound, a layout including limited bends.
Hissing
Hissing noise that happens when a faucet is opened a little typically signals extreme water pressure. Consult your regional water company if you think this problem; it will certainly have the ability to tell you the water pressure in your location and also can set up a pressurereducing valve on the incoming supply of water pipeline if needed.
Thudding
Thudding noise, frequently accompanied by shuddering pipelines, when a tap or home appliance shutoff is switched off is a problem called water hammer. The sound and also vibration are caused by the reverberating wave of stress in the water, which unexpectedly has no location to go. Sometimes opening up a shutoff that discharges water quickly right into a section of piping including a constraint, elbow, or tee installation can produce the very same condition.
Water hammer can typically be healed by setting up installations called air chambers or shock absorbers in the plumbing to which the problem valves or taps are linked. These gadgets allow the shock wave developed by the halted flow of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ems may have brief upright sections of capped pipeline behind walls on faucet runs for the very same function; these can ultimately loaded with water, decreasing or destroying their effectiveness. The treatment is to drain pipes the water system totally by shutting off the main water supply shutoff and also opening up all faucets. Then open up the major supply shutoff as well as close the faucets individually, beginning with the faucet nearest the shutoff as well as ending with the one farthest away.
Babbling or Shrieking
Intense chattering or screeching that takes place when a valve or faucet is turned on, which generally goes away when the installation is opened totally, signals loosened or faulty interior parts. The solution is to replace the shutoff or tap with a brand-new one.
Pumps and devices such as cleaning machines and also dishwashers can move motor noise to pipelines if they are poorly linked. Link such items to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Various Other Inlet Side Noises
Squeaking, squeaking, scratching, breaking, as well as tapping normally are caused by the development or contraction of pipelines, generally copper ones providing warm water. The noises occur as the pipelines slide against loosened fasteners or strike neighboring house framework. You can typically pinpoint the place of the problem if the pipelines are exposed; simply comply with the noise when the pipes are making sounds. Most likely you will certainly discover a loosened pipe wall mount or an area where pipelines lie so near flooring joists or other framing items that they clatter against them. Attaching foam pipeline insulation around the pipes at the point of contact must fix the trouble. Make sure straps and also hangers are safe and secure as well as give sufficient assistance. Where possible, pipeline fasteners should be connected to huge architectural aspects such as structure walls rather than to mounting; doing so reduces the transmission of resonances from plumbing to surfaces that can intensify and move them. If connecting bolts to framework is unavoidable, wrap pipelines with insulation or various other durable product where they get in touch with bolts, and sandwich completions of new fasteners in between rubber washers when installing them.
Dealing with plumbing runs that struggle with flow-restricting limited or numerous bends is a last hope that needs to be carried out just after consulting an experienced plumbing service provider. Unfortunately, this situation is relatively usual in older houses that may not have actually been constructed with indoor plumbing or that have seen a number of remodels, specifically by amateurs.
Drainpipe Sound
On the drain side of plumbing, the principal objectives are to eliminate surface areas that can be struck by falling or hurrying water and to protect pipes to have unavoidable sounds.
In brand-new building and construction, bathtubs, shower stalls, bathrooms, and also wallmounted sinks and containers need to be set on or against durable underlayments to lower the transmission of sound with them. Water-saving commodes and faucets are much less loud than conventional designs; mount them instead of older kinds even if codes in your area still permit making use of older fixtures.
Drainpipes that do not run up and down to the cellar or that branch into horizontal pipeline runs sustained at flooring joists or other framing existing specifically troublesome noise issues. Such pipelines are huge sufficient to radiate significant vibration; they also bring considerable amounts of water, which makes the scenario even worse. In brand-new construction, specify cast-iron soil pipelines (the big pipelines that drain pipes commodes) if you can afford them. Their massiveness includes much of the noise made by water going through them. Likewise, prevent transmitting drains in wall surfaces shown to rooms and rooms where people gather. Walls including drainpipes should be soundproofed as was described earlier, using double panels of sound-insulating fiberboard and wallboard. Pipes themselves can be wrapped with special fiberglass insulation produced the function; such pipes have an invulnerable vinyl skin (often including lead). Results are not always satisfying.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
